Dramatic Interpretation of Shakespeare 
An assessment of group presentations based on various scenes from Shakespeare

  Poor

1 pts

Average

3 pts

Competent

5 pts

Excellent

7 pts

Content/Meaning

Sound understanding, analysis, and explanation, of the writing task and text(s).

Poor

Interpretation conveys a confused or largely inaccurate understanding of the scene, audience, & purpose. Unclear analysis and/or unwarranted explanations.
Average

Interpretation conveys a partly accurate understanding of the scene, audience, & purpose. Limited analysis or superficial insights.
Competent

Interpretation conveys an accurate & complete understanding of the scene, audience, and purpose. Clear & explicit analysis and explanation.
Excellent

Interpretation conveys an accurate & in-depth understanding of the scene, audience, and purpose. Insightful & thorough analysis.
Presentation

Voice projection. Entertainment value.

Poor

Not prepared. Read from a piece of paper & had difficulty reading lines. Not very creative. Too short.
Average

Group is mostly prepared; forgot some of their lines. Presentation is basic - not very creative. Too short.
Competent

Group is adequately prepared. Presentation is interesting and informative as well as creative spin.
Excellent

Group is well prepared. Very entertaining and informative - creative spin on scene. The "wow' factor.
Setting/Creativity

Props, set design, costumes.

Poor

Little to no evidence of props, or costume theme.
Average

Some aspects of the costume theme are evident but not complete and/or do not compliment your interpretation of the scene.
Competent

The props & costume theme were well thought and organized and complimented your interpretation of the scene.
Excellent

Exceptional props & costume theme were evident and distinctly complimented your interpretation of the scene.
Maturity and Earnestness

Poor

This assignment was a not completed respectfully.
Average

Some maturity was shown throughout but not enough to make the grade
Competent

Maturity and earnestness were presented in the dramatic interpretation
Excellent

The assignment was taken seriously, and the maturity and earnestness took the scene to a whole new level
